In this eerily beautiful film, director Jonathon Kay offers a novel blend of sci-fi, action-adventure and eco-drama. Set in the present at the time of our current world ecological crisis the film centers around Arianna (Rae Dawn Chong), an enchanting alien who arrives on Earth in search of a mutant DNA strand that will allow her people to live in the Earth's polluted atmosphere.
She meets Kieran, (Billy Wirth) a fiery young man in whom she finds the sought-after DNA. Enter Pallas, the deranged renegade from Arianna's planet also in search of the DNA, and conflict begins to brew. In the center of the action is Kieran's powerful shaman grandfather, Grampa Lium (Willie Nelson), who draws on Native American spirituality, particularly a belief in extraterrestrial saviors. Dazzling futuristic sequences and haunting flashbacks set the background for this star-studded cast and original storyline.
